A scientific observation must be... - (ANSWER)reproducible



The study of stars, planets and other objects in space is known as - (ANSWER)Astronomy



Kepler's first law of planetary motion says - (ANSWER)Planets orbit the Sun along elliptical paths



Scalars are quantities with what properties?

Magnitude? Direction? Both? - (ANSWER)Magnitude only

Which statement is NOT consistent with Newton's laws of motion?



a) For every action there is an equal and opposite reaction.

b) F = ma

c) An object will undergo uniform motion in the absence of an external force.

d) Acceleration is caused by balanced forces. - (ANSWER)d) Acceleration is caused by balanced forces.



What is the unit for power? - (ANSWER)kg∙m2/s3

Which of the following is NOT a kind of potential energy?

a) Gravitational

b) Thermal

c) Electrical

d) Elastic - (ANSWER)b) Thermal



Which of the following is the best statement regarding the interchangeability of energy?



a) Any type of energy can be converted into any other type of energy.

b) No type of energy can be converted into another type of energy.

c) Any type of energy can be converted into only select other kinds, depending on the situation.

d) Some types of energy can be converted into a few other kinds of energy. - (ANSWER)a) Any type of
energy can be converted into any other type of energy



Which of the following is a statement of the First Law of Thermodynamics?



a) In an open system, the total amount of entropy is conserved.

b) In an open system, the total amount of energy is conserved.

c) In a closed system, the total amount of energy is conserved.

d) In a closed system, the total amount of entropy is conserved. - (ANSWER)c) In a closed system, the
total amount of energy is conserved.
